引言
在数字化时代,网络安全已成为企业和个人关注的焦点。安全漏洞测试是确保网络安全的重要手段之一。本文将深入解析如何轻松上手安全漏洞测试工具,帮助您全方位守护网络安全。
什么是安全漏洞测试?
安全漏洞测试(Vulnerability Testing)是一种评估系统和应用程序中潜在安全风险的技术。通过测试,可以发现系统中存在的安全漏洞,并及时进行修复,防止恶意攻击者利用这些漏洞发起攻击。
常用的安全漏洞测试工具
Nessus:Nessus 是一款功能强大的漏洞扫描工具,能够检测出各种系统和应用程序的漏洞。它提供了丰富的插件库,支持多种扫描模式和报告格式。
OpenVAS:OpenVAS 是一款开源的漏洞扫描工具,与 Nessus 类似,同样具备强大的功能和插件库。它支持自动化扫描、远程扫描和本地扫描。
Burp Suite:Burp Suite 是一款专注于Web应用安全测试的工具。它提供了多种测试功能,包括代理、扫描、爬虫、 Intruder 和 repeater 等。
AWVS:AWVS(Acunetix Web Vulnerability Scanner)是一款专业的Web应用漏洞扫描工具,能够检测多种Web应用漏洞,如SQL注入、跨站脚本(XSS)等。
ZAP:ZAP(Zed Attack Proxy)是一款开源的Web安全测试工具,具备多种测试功能,如扫描、爬虫、攻击和监控。
如何上手安全漏洞测试工具?
1. 学习基础知识
在开始使用安全漏洞测试工具之前,您需要了解一些基础知识,如:
- 操作系统和网络基础知识
- Web应用安全知识
- 常见的安全漏洞类型
2. 选择合适的工具
根据您的需求,选择一款适合的工具。如果您是新手,可以从 Nessus 或 OpenVAS 开始。
3. 安装和配置
下载并安装您选择的工具,然后进行配置。对于 Nessus 和 OpenVAS,您需要创建一个账户并导入证书。
4. 制定测试计划
根据您的测试需求,制定测试计划。例如,您可以选择对整个网络进行扫描,或者只针对特定的系统或应用程序。
5. 执行测试
运行测试并观察结果。对于发现的漏洞,您需要分析原因并采取相应的修复措施。
6. 生成报告
大多数安全漏洞测试工具都提供了报告功能。您可以根据需要生成详细的测试报告,以便于跟踪和评估漏洞修复情况。
总结
通过学习本文,您应该已经掌握了如何轻松上手安全漏洞测试工具。在实际应用中,请务必遵循以下原则:
- 定期进行安全漏洞测试
- 及时修复发现的漏洞
- 持续关注网络安全动态
希望本文能帮助您全方位守护网络安全,预防潜在的安全风险。